Objective

 
 


ISAP2021 is intended to provide an international forum for the exchange of information on the progress of research and development in antennas, propagation, electromagnetic-wave theory, and related fields as shown in the Conference Topics (Home). It is also an important objective of this meeting to promote mutual interaction among participants.
